Standardized incidence ratios and risk factors for cancer in patients with systemic sclerosis: Data from the Spanish Scleroderma Registry (RESCLE) Cristina Carbonell , Miguel Marcos , Alfredo Guillén-Del-Castillo , Manuel Rubio-Rivas , Ana Argibay , Adela Marín-Ballvé , Ignasi Rodríguez-Pintó , Maria Baldà-Masmiquel , Eduardo Callejas-Moraga , Dolores Colunga , Luis Sáez-Comet , Cristina González-Echávarri , Norberto Ortego-Centeno , Begoña Marí-Alfonso , José-Antonio Vargas-Hitos , José-Antonio Todolí-Parra , Luis Trapiella , María-Teresa Herranz-Marín , Mayka Freire , Antoni Castro-Salomó , Isabel Perales-Fraile , Ana-Belén Madroñero-Vuelta , María-Esther Sánchez-García , Manuel Ruiz-Muñoz , Andrés González-García , Jorge Sánchez-Redondo , Gloria de-la-Red-Bellvis , Alejandra Fernández-Luque , Alberto Muela-Molinero , Gema-María Lledó , Carles Tolosa-Vilella , Vicent Fonollosa-Pla , Antonio-Javier Chamorro , Carmen-Pilar Simeón-Aznar Autoimmunity Reviews(2022)
摘要
•Systemic sclerosis patients have increased risk of lung, breast, and blood cancer.•Primary biliary cholangitis is linked to a 6-fold greater risk of breast cancer.•Moderate or severe interstitial lung disease is linked to a higher risk of cancer.•Anti-centromere antibodies are associated with a lower risk of cancer.
